So, Shank is this gritty take on urban life, set in a world where knives rule and the streets are just chaotic. The pacing can be relentless, matching the turmoil of the characters. You've got the Paper Chazers, a gang that stands out because they’re not just about the mayhem—they're trading food, trying to survive. It dives deep into themes of morality amidst chaos, which is pretty compelling. The performances feel raw, with a certain edge that makes you believe these folks are real. Practical effects add to that visceral atmosphere. It’s not your typical action flick; it’s more about the struggle and the blurry line between right and wrong.
